The Rainy Lake Gymnastics Academy is teaming up with Fort Frances GM.
Owner Nick Beyak is providing what’s described as a significant donation as part of a five-year agreement with the Academy as it prepares to open this fall.
Director Stephanie Mann says they are thrilled with Beyak’s support.
“We certainly couldn’t be doing what we’re doing and starting the club this year without his support, so having him partner with us and the gymnastics club is incredible,” says Mann.
Mann says the money will help with the purchase of equipment and other operating costs.
“He’s invested a good amount of money to help us purchase equipment and get things rolling for the year so we appreciate his support more than we’ll be ever able to tell him I’m sure.”
The Academy will hold registration for its inaugural year at Fort Frances GM on August 27 from 5-8 p.m.
Mann says they were hoping to start in September but a delay in getting the necessary equipment to Fort Frances will push that to October 1.
